Sleep support splints are effective.

My carpal tunnel syndrome was painful. I experienced severe pins and needles sensations (tingling, numbness, and pricking) as well as limited movement. 

My doctor recommended wearing splints at night to maintain a correct position and improve circulation. The goal was to restore function and provide relief to the affected tissue and nerves.

By wearing the splints faithfully over time, I was fortunate and resolved the issue without surgery. Eventually I could take splint breaks without noticeable symptoms. 

To this day, if I have even a slight tingle, I immediately resume the splinting until it resolves. I sometimes use a small day splint as a preventative to maintain a neutral wrist position on excessive typing days, as well as a padded keyboard support and mouse pad. 

Although splinting was an effective treatment for me, it’s always recommended if you have a concern or are experiencing symptoms to consult with your provider. 

Many recommend and support the use of splints, but it’s also important to review other available treatment options and rule out any underlying conditions.


Splints are an effective treatment for many carpal tunnel sufferers, and their design has improved over the years.

The flesh toned, bulky, and unsightly orthopedic models of yesterday with rough fabric clamps and brackets have been replaced by Velcro straps, soft fabric, and padded interiors.

I’ve tried many different splints searching for the most comfortable fit and attractive model. This one is my favorite.

FUTURO Night Wrist Sleep Support 

This splint has a comfortable sleeve design and is adjustable, ambidextrous, and durable. I found the cushion really comfortable and the palmar splint effective for maintaining a neutral position. 

The color is a deeper blue so it maintains a fresher look with use. FYI. It’s not made with natural fabrics if that’s a concern.

Where to purchase the FUTURO Night Wrist Sleep Support and cost.

The FUTURO Night Wrist Sleep Support, made by the 3M Company is available for purchase on-line, and in select chain pharmacies and retail stores. 

Price ranges from $26 to $35 on-line from retail stores (Walmart and Target) for a single support and $19.99 for a single on Amazon. 

Sometimes local retail pharmacies have special sales on FUTURO products making them more budget friendly, but I haven’t seen one for awhile.

These splints are sturdy, durable, effective, comfortable and long lasting. It’s money well spent.
